Python批量屏蔽代码

在编程领域中,有时我们需要批量处理代码,特别是在大型项目中。有时,我们可能需要对某些代码进行屏蔽,以便在特定情况下禁止其执行。本文将介绍如何使用Python批量屏蔽代码,并提供一些示例。

1. 什么是代码屏蔽?

代码屏蔽是指禁止代码在特定情况下执行,以便在不删除或注释掉代码的情况下进行测试、调试或其他目的。屏蔽代码的一种常见方法是使用注释符号,如在Python中使用井号(#)来注释掉代码块。

2. 批量屏蔽代码的方法

在Python中,我们可以使用以下方法批量屏蔽代码:

  • 使用注释符号(#)注释掉代码块。
  • 使用条件语句判断是否执行代码块。

3. 使用注释符号(#)屏蔽代码

使用注释符号(#)屏蔽代码是一种简单有效的方法。在Python中,我们可以使用#符号来注释掉一行或多行代码。以下是一些示例:

# 屏蔽单行代码
# print("Hello, World!")

# 屏蔽多行代码
"""
print("Hello, World!")
print("Hello, Python!")
"""

在上面的示例中,我们使用了#符号将代码注释掉。这样,在运行程序时,这些被注释的代码就不会被执行。

4. 使用条件语句屏蔽代码

另一种方法是使用条件语句来判断是否执行代码块。这种方法更加灵活,可以根据具体的条件来决定是否执行代码。以下是一个示例:

flag = False

if flag:
    print("Hello, World!")

# 如果flag为True,则执行代码

在上面的示例中,我们使用了一个简单的布尔变量flag来判断是否执行代码。如果flag的值为True,则会执行代码块中的语句。

5. 批量屏蔽代码的应用场景

在实际开发中,我们经常会遇到需要批量屏蔽代码的情况。以下是一些常见的应用场景:

  • 调试代码:在调试过程中,我们可能需要暂时屏蔽一些代码,以便更容易定位和修复问题。
  • 测试代码:在进行单元测试或功能测试时,我们可能需要屏蔽掉一些不相关的代码,以便更专注于测试目标。
  • 特定环境代码:有时,我们可能需要根据代码运行的环境来决定是否执行某些代码块。例如,测试环境和生产环境可能需要执行不同的代码。

6. 结论

通过注释符号(#)或条件语句,我们可以轻松地批量屏蔽代码。这种方法可以帮助我们在不删除或注释代码的情况下进行调试、测试和其他操作。对于大型项目或长期维护的代码,代码屏蔽是一个很有用的技巧。

希望本文对你了解如何使用Python批量屏蔽代码有所帮助。祝你编程愉快!


附录:示例代码

以下是一个使用条件语句屏蔽代码的示例。假设我们有一个列表,我们只想打印列表中大于等于5的元素。

numbers = [1, 2, 3, 4, 5, 6, 7, 8, 9, 10]

for num in numbers:
    if num >= 5:
        print(num)

通过这样的条件语句,我们可以根据具体的需求来选择要执行的代码。在这个例子中,我们只打印大于等于5的数字。你可以根据自己的需求来修改条件,实现特定的功能。


**附录:饼